The county is served by the Fairfax County Public Schools system, to which the county government allocates 52.2% of its budget. [38] Including state and federal government contributions, along with citizen and corporate contributions, this brings the 2023 budget for the school system to $3.5 billion.

In 1956, the Fairfax County Board of Supervisors formed an advisory group on economic development called the Industrial Development Commission.
